3 hours ago, Brianl said:

Top build.

I like the details like the wheel treatment that gives the car attitude, the white roof lining and engine detail. What paint did you use?

Brian

 

Hello Brian,

There's a lot of grey area in your question. Various companies. If your question is on the body, Tamiya white primer, then Black Gold's Orion Silver Metallic, then Black Gold's Kandy Brandywine, finished off with Testor's Wet Look, and then polished out, and finally I used Meguire's Ultimate Polish on it. 

Hope that answered your question!
